algebra.std

LongAlgebra

class LongAlgebra extends EuclideanRing[Long] with Order[Long] with Signed[Long] with IsIntegral[Long] with Serializable

Linear Supertypes
IsIntegral[Long], IsReal[Long], Signed[Long], Order[Long], PartialOrder[Long], Eq[Long], EuclideanRing[Long], CommutativeRing[Long], CommutativeRig[Long], MultiplicativeCommutativeMonoid[Long], MultiplicativeCommutativeSemigroup[Long], ring.Ring[Long], Rng[Long], AdditiveCommutativeGroup[Long], AdditiveGroup[Long], Rig[Long], MultiplicativeMonoid[Long], Semiring[Long], MultiplicativeSemigroup[Long], AdditiveCommutativeMonoid[Long], AdditiveCommutativeSemigroup[Long], AdditiveMonoid[Long], AdditiveSemigroup[Long], Serializable, Serializable, AnyRef, Any
